What happened in China in the 1900s?
In 1900, China was heavily controlled by foreign nations who tended to dominate the ports such as Shanghai. China was ruled by the Qing family, though the family is better known as the Manchu’s. In 1894-95, Japan attacked China. This also led to defeat and Japan took from China Korea, Formosa (Taiwan) and Port Arthur.

Why did the Chinese resented the foreigners in the 20th century?
The Chinese resented foreigners control and expressed this at the beginning of the 20thcentury with the Boxer Rebellion. At the same time, the traditional government of China began to fail in the early years.
